#0186d9 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#0186d9 is composed of 0.4% red, 52.5% green and 85.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 99.5% cyan, 38.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 203.1 degrees, a saturation of 99.1% and a lightness of 42.7%. #0186d9 color hex could be obtained by blending #02ffff with #000db3. Closest websafe color is: #0099cc.

● #0186d9 color description : Vivid blue.
The hexadecimal color #0186d9 has RGB values of R:1, G:134, B:217 and CMYK values of C:1, M:0.38, Y:0,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 100057.
